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of Core i3-9100TE and Core i7-6970HQ

Intel

Core i3-9100TE

The Core i3-9100TE is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 1 April 2019 (6 years ago). It is based on the Coffee Lake (2017−2019) architecture. It features 4 cores and 4 threads. Base frequency is 2.2 GHz, with boost up to 3.2 GHz. L3 cache: 6 MB (total). L2 cache: 256K (per core). Built on 14 nm process technology. Socket: LGA1151. Thermal design power (TDP): 35 Watt. Memory support: DDR4-2400. Passmark benchmark score: 4,589 points. Launch price was $69.

Intel

Core i7-6970HQ

The Core i7-6970HQ is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 2 January 2016 (9 years ago). It is based on the Skylake (2015−2016) architecture. It features 4 cores and 8 threads. Base frequency is 2.8 GHz, with boost up to 3.7 GHz. L3 cache: 8 MB. L2 cache: 1 MB. Built on 14 nm process technology. Socket: BGA1440. Thermal design power (TDP): 45 Watt. Memory support: DDR3, DDR4. Passmark benchmark score: 4,632 points. Launch price was $623.

Processing Power

The Core i3-9100TE packs 4 cores / 4 threads, matching the Core i7-6970HQ's 4 cores. Boost clocks reach 3.2 GHz on the Core i3-9100TE versus 3.7 GHz on the Core i7-6970HQ — a 14.5% clock advantage for the Core i7-6970HQ (base: 2.2 GHz vs 2.8 GHz). The Core i3-9100TE uses the Coffee Lake (2017−2019) architecture (14 nm), while the Core i7-6970HQ uses Skylake (2015−2016) (14 nm). In PassMark, the Core i3-9100TE scores 4,589 against the Core i7-6970HQ's 4,632 — a 0.9% lead for the Core i7-6970HQ. L3 cache: 6 MB (total) on the Core i3-9100TE vs 8 MB on the Core i7-6970HQ.
